WebMar 14, 2024 · Hot tubs lose around 60% of their heat through the surface of their water. Which means a poorly insulated, cracked, or damaged hot tub cover that does a terrible job of trapping your hot tub’s heat in could cost you an arm and a leg over the years. WebEnergy efficiency is a huge deal when it comes to hot tubs. You can expect to spend about $25 extra on your monthly power bill for a high end super efficient 240V hot tub, or $75 if you buy a piece of crap $1000 spa. Beyond that, be prepared to realistically spend $300 to $500 annually for chemicals. WebJun 30, 2024 · Even still, my hot tub bill is regularly $200/month. Also note that if you drain your hot tub and refill it with cold water, the electrical cost to reheat the tub to your desire temperature will increase a lot. I recommend changing the water every 3-6 months. Total annual operating costs of a hot tub: $1,000 – $2,500 The Benefits Of Owning A ... WebFeb 16, 2024 · To install an in-ground hot tub at your home, expect to pay an average of $8,000 to $25,000. The cost of this project depends on the size of the hot tub, materials for the interior and exterior, which features and customizations you add, and more. An in-ground hot tub with basic, minimally customized features will cost on the lower end, …

WebA Stoked Stainless wood fired hot tub takes on average 2.5 hours to heat up from cold to 38 degrees C, while a standard electric hot tub of the same size can take up to 15 hours to heat! Clearly a wood fired tub is the winner in this situation.
